Output 81fc7721fc0aaa6df37eafb1c5fb003a15aca2f22e3f081266ff1539952617da:9

value
521263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ebfdd1148e24facdb713c46f202b5c315a8b1ad OP_EQUAL
address
34Vc3DDfn8WnfhAC6DJxDA5RJwqUtwJz4n
transaction
81fc7721fc0aaa6df37eafb1c5fb003a15aca2f22e3f081266ff1539952617da
spent
true